Chapter 177: 177
Upon seeing the ferocious looking sea monster, who turned out to be kind-hearted, showing a shocked expression on his face that was covered with faint blue and yellow scales, the old man riding on the strange fish smiled . Then, he gently loosened his grip on his mount's mane before finally looking around greedily at the blue ocean and the clear sky .
Afterward, a sacred, fearless expression crept upon his face . Stretching both his arms out, he stared at the animal skin on Zhang Lisheng's hand before proceeding to do a gesture to signify that he's praying .
In an instant, soft white light emitted out of the old man as his body began to drift away bit by bit on the roll of animal skin .
This bizarre scene startled Zhang Lisheng .
His body froze abruptly, all of the muscles on his body bulged out like chunks of steel .
However, after a moment of vigilance, the young man noticed that nothing else happened other than the old man slowly turning into a ball of light and his body slowly dissipating away .
"Why go all the trouble to burn yourself up like a lightbulb if all you're doing is committing suicide? What does this actually mean?" After about thirty to fifty seconds, Zhang Lisheng looked at the old man who turned into nothingness, leaving behind his grey robe on the strange fish, before muttering to himself, "Transforming into light and illuminating these tadpole-like words on the animal skin . . . but it's not like I know this language… It's not like I understand them at all…"
As he was speaking, he lowered his head unwittingly and looked at the animal skin roll . To his surprise, even though the strange tadpole-like words on it did not change, as if it was a miracle, he somehow understood its meaning!
"When I was chasing the migration of the Evnado Merpeople in the sea, I unwittingly embarked on a huge remote island in the Hellfire Archipelago, where the barbarians live . I found a group of exiles who mastered the superb alchemical machinery technology… Those exiles seem to be living on steel ships on a daily basis, but they have already opened up a small settlement on the island . Judging from how the Hellfire barbarians allowed them to build houses on the island, I suspect they must have learned a harsh lesson from these people already . I'm very happy about this . I found out that after those exiles have settled down on the island, they treat the barbarians kindly . They exchanged bright mirrors and black sweets that give out a peculiar intoxicating scent with the Hellfire barbarians for plant seeds that are completely valueless and even reclaimed wasteland to domesticate these seeds . It seems like this should be a good branch of a farming civilization . . . "
When Zhang Lisheng reached this part, he noticed that the wording written on the roll of animal skin in his hand had reached the end . "This seems to be a diary that doesn't have much context…" Perplexed, he muttered to himself and noticed that all of the wording on the roll of animal skin disappeared before lines of new words emerged to replace them .
"I pretended to be a Hellfire barbarian and made a trade with the exiles at the settlement . The longer I spent my time with them, the more obvious I could sense the same aura of a higher civilized race from them… Their language is extremely complicated . Even if I have the Eternal Comprehension Spell that I'm fortunate to have obtained from the Gaia Ancient Temple Ruins, it took me a full 12 days to finally communicate with them freely… it's the 12th day today . The Eternal Comprehension Spell has already taken effect, and I learned that the sweet was called 'Chocolate' from its wrapping . What a strange name this is, but it was indeed delicious . I'll tell these kind exiles later just how wrong it is for them to choose to form alliances with the ferocious barbarians . Civilized people should choose to become allies with civilized people instead, just like us Kattaman City State…"
"God! I was wrong! I-I've made a grave self-righteous mistake! Traveling from afar by ship doesn't mean those people are exiles! They're from a different world! From a-another realm! The fantastical descriptions written by Gaia Ancient God in the epic 'The Century' is actually real! The other world does exist! Could it be that millions of years ago, after the 'Six Days Catastrophe' took place, our world had indeed become a negligible part of a huge and unparalleled 'Colossal World' for a period of time before? I'll leave this island tomorrow and tell the invasion of these people from the other world to all civilized countries . They have come… The Hellfire barbarians have found the cave where I secretly lived . Under the horror of yesterday, I've forgotten my usual meticulousness . These damn barbarians did not listen to me and instead attacked me! I fled to the beach with all my might and rode on the newly domesticated Hairy Dolfish to escape…"
"Dear kind sea beast, I sacrificed my life that doesn't have much time left to cast the Eternal Comprehension Spell so you can understand the content of the words I wrote on this magic wolf skin paper . As the same intelligent being from the Gaia World, despite our differences in race, I sincerely hope you can abandon your hatred towards the people of this land in the face of righteousness and give my diary to Lord Adia, the Chief Superintendent of Blue Whale City in the Kattaman City State . Bring my grey robe as a token and tell him you're the messenger of the Fog Explorer Armandnik, and he'll definitely see you . By that time, please hand over this roll of magic wolf skin paper to Lord Adia, and you'll surely get a good reward . Not only that, you may even become a great figure in history! This matter is very important to our entire world . I pray that you, kind sea monster, will pass the news at any cost…"
Zhang Lisheng read all of the contents on the magic wolf skin paper roll in one breath and unwittingly fell into deep thought .
The descriptions of Gaia Ancient God, the epic "The Century", the Six Days Catastrophe, the Colossal World seemed to be forming a faint context of connection with the 'bookmarks' and 'pages' he knew before, which was pointing towards the truth .
